Output 38500b8d8da56df2e2e8e57ff2825fb263f68133b5bb53df780c19eefe36c8d6:0

value
65942306
script pubkey
OP_0 OP_PUSHBYTES_20 eba74303059aa9a73ea3966d76281abfc280b1f3
address
ltc1qawn5xqc9n256w04rjekhv2q6hlpgpv0n3pgcfv
transaction
38500b8d8da56df2e2e8e57ff2825fb263f68133b5bb53df780c19eefe36c8d6
spent
true